Air:
Guwahati Airport, or Lokpriya Gopinath Bordoloi International Airport, situated 25 km away from the main city, links the destination with all prime Indian cities. Regular flight options are available by 8 different carriers such as Indigo, Air India, AirAsia India, and Jet Airways for cities such as Delhi, Kolkata, Mumbai, Chennai, Lucknow, Hyderabad, Bengaluru, Imphal, Dibrugarh, Aizawl, Dimapur, Bagdogra, Patna, Itanagar, Silchar, Jorhat, among others. Travellers can avail bus or prepaid taxi services to reach desired destination in Guwahati.
Train:
Guwahati Railway Station, which is just 5 km away from the city centre, is one of the prime railheads in Assam. The station is well connected to all major Indian cities via broad rail network. Rajdhani Express, a premium train, takes about 34 hours to reach Guwahati from New Delhi. From outside the station, travellers can hire a cab or take a bus to reach Guwahati.
Road:
The city of Guwahati is well linked with several adjoining cities and towns via number of Assam State Transport Corporation (ASTC) and other private buses. Depending upon their requirement, travellers can choose from Volvo, deluxe, air conditioned or luxury buses. Several major national highways meet at Guwahati so one can easily drive from Tripura, Arunachal Pradesh, Manipur, West Bengal and Nagaland.
